I used to flush. I was convinced that lack of flushing is what lead to buds that wont burn up completely and leave black ash instead of a gray/white ash.

I have since changed my stance on the issue. I've found that the black nasty ash is caused by not drying it enough before the cure.

I would imagine this happens for 2 reasons:

1. People tend to be in a hurry. They want that money asap.

2. If you don't dry it completely, it will end up having a bit more weight, per bud, and a profitable amount for quantity.


I did a test all my own. I didn't flush at all- dried the bud completely and the ash burned gray/white. :D

That being said, I don't feed them right up until harvest but when I noticed her finishing up (retracting pistils, fattened calyxes, trichome color - about a week, to 1.5 weeks) I just give Ph'd water until harvest and I've had great results.

I know lots of people still swear by flushing (I was one of them). But once I did my own test, I found out the truth. Also, hot damn it saves a lot of time and energy not having to flush with obscene amounts of water.

Just Ph'd water and let her eat the rest of the nutes in the grow medium and root system. The plants leaves will yellow (same thing as deciduous trees leaves changing color and falling off) as the nutrients are absorbed. I don't put massive amounts of water through, I just do a heavy watering, with about 20% run off, and then let the plant drink it dry. Check trichomes and calyxes and decide to harvest or give some more water.
